About the role

Balfour Beatty is looking for a commercially minded and influential Senior Legal Counsel to play a pivotal role in shaping legal strategy across our Regional Buildings Business Unit. As a senior member of our UK Construction Services Legal team, you’ll partner closely with senior leaders to enable growth, support winning bids and safeguard long‑term value across major Defence, Transport, Aviation and Science & Technical projects.

In this highly impactful role, you’ll lead negotiations on complex, high‑value bids and live projects—helping the business take informed, balanced decisions that strengthen competitiveness while protecting our commercial position. You’ll work at the heart of a rapidly evolving environment, providing pragmatic, solutions‑focused advice that supports operational delivery and fosters trusted client relationships.

What you’ll be doing

  • Lead legal strategy and negotiations on complex, high‑value bids, tenders and project agreements across major Defence and Buildings programmes.
  • Drive commercially focused, risk‑balanced solutions that support winning work while protecting long‑term value.
  • Shape negotiation strategy, identifying deal‑critical risks, viable trade‑offs and creative commercial solutions.
  • Oversee the development and implementation of legal processes, policies and standard documents.
  • Provide senior legal governance during bid reviews, advising on bid/no‑bid decisions, departures and risk appetite.
  • Partner with commercial, operational and bid teams to deliver clear, pragmatic legal advice aligned to client and business objectives.
  • Manage external legal advisers, including budget oversight, on complex matters and dispute resolution processes.
  • Provide expert support on disputes, adjudications and alternative dispute resolution.
  • Review, negotiate and advise on bonds, guarantees, warranties and other commercial instruments.
  • Lead, coach and develop team members, contributing to the wider capability development of the legal community.

Who we’re looking for

  • Strong experience within construction or infrastructure, ideally across defence or government‑regulated environments
  • Extensive working knowledge of NEC3 and NEC4 contracts
  • Proven ability to lead complex negotiations and manage high‑value contractual risk
  • Sound understanding of UK government contracting requirements, including procurement and defence‑related regulations
  • Commercially minded, with the judgement to balance legal risk and business opportunity
  • Confident communicator, able to influence and advise at senior leadership level
  • Pragmatic, solutions‑focused approach to problem‑solving
  • Experience managing or mentoring legal team members
